比特币是一种去中心化的数字货币,最早在2009年由一个化名中本聪(Satoshi Nakamoto)的人或团队发布。比特币的成功不仅在于其货币本身的价值,更在于其背后的技术——区块链,以及随之而来的各种服务和产品,其中最为重要的便是比特币钱包。比特币钱包主要分为热钱包和冷钱包,分别用于日常交易和长期存储。那么,比特币钱包由谁设计制造呢?接下来,我们将对比特币钱包的创作背景、类型、以及如何确保钱包安全进行深入探讨。

比特币钱包的历史与创始人

比特币钱包的灵魂是中本聪在比特币白皮书中所描述的功能与架构。早期比特币钱包有几个版本,松散地与中本聪的活动相关。2009年,随着第一版比特币客户端(Bitcoin-Qt)的发布,用户被赋予了存储和发送比特币的能力。该客户端中包含了最基本的钱包功能,用户可以生成公钥和私钥对,从而用于比特币的交易。

随着技术的进步,许多第三方开发者开始进入比特币钱包的市场,推出了多种不同类型的钱包。2010年,第一款第三方比特币钱包“Blockchain.info”就此诞生。于是,比特币钱包的创作逐渐成为一个多元化的领域,由不同的团队和个人共同推动其发展。

比特币钱包的类型

比特币钱包主要有三种类型:热钱包、冷钱包和纸钱包。每种类型都有其独特的优势与劣势,用户可以根据自身的需求来选择合适的钱包。

热钱包:热钱包是连接互联网的钱包,适合频繁交易的用户。常见的热钱包包括手机钱包和网络钱包。这类钱包的优点在于操作方便、易于访问,但由于其在线特性,安全性相对较低。

冷钱包:冷钱包则是离线的钱包,适合长期保存比特币。硬件钱包(例如Trezor和Ledger)和专用设备属于冷钱包的一部分。由于其离线特性,冷钱包提供了更高的安全性,是存储大量比特币时的优选。

纸钱包:纸钱包是一种通过打印比特币的公钥和私钥来实现存储的方式。这是一种极其谨慎的存储方法,适合长期持有,但若一旦纸张损坏或遗失,则比特币将无法找回。

比特币钱包的安全性

随着比特币的普及,钱包的安全性也愈发重要。几乎每个比特币钱包都受到黑客攻击的威胁。因此,用户需要采取多种安全措施以确保其数字资产的安全。

密码保护:所有钱包都应该设有复杂的密码保护。建议用户使用包含大写字母、小写字母、数字和特殊字符的密码。此外,定期更改密码也是保护钱包的措施之一。

双重认证:许多钱包服务提供双重认证(2FA),这是提高安全性的有效方式。用户不仅需要输入密码,还需要输入通过其他设备(如手机)生成的验证码。

备份:定期备份钱包数据是确保资金安全的一个重要步骤。无论是热钱包还是冷钱包,用户都应该定期将私钥和助记词备份到安全的地方。

更新软件:钱包软件的更新通常包含安全漏洞的修复,所以保持钱包软件的最新版本是保护用户资产的重要步骤。

相关问题探讨

比特币钱包的选择标准是什么?

在选择比特币钱包时,用户需要考虑以下几项关键标准:

安全性:对于数字资产的保护至关重要。用户应该选择那些已被业界认可并具备良好安全记录的钱包。例如,知名的硬件钱包通常采用多重安全保护措施来防止资金损失。

易用性:钱包的操作界面是否友好直接影响用户的使用体验。特别是对于初学者来说,简单易用的钱包可以有效降低学习成本。

支持币种:除了比特币,许多钱包还支持其他加密货币。因此,如果用户有多种数字资产,选择一个支持多种币种的钱包会更加便利。

社区与支持:活跃的用户社区和技术支持团队能够及时解决遇到的问题也是选择钱包的重要因素。如此一来,用户在使用过程中可以获得更多的帮助与指导。

如何防止比特币钱包被盗?

比特币钱包的盗窃事件屡见不鲜,因此,用户需要采取一系列措施以防止钱包被盗。

增强密码复杂性:使用强密码是保护钱包的第一道防线,避免使用容易被猜测的密码,如生日或简单的数字组合。

定期更换密码:即使密码很复杂,仍然建议定期更换,以降低被盗风险。

使用安全的网络:在公共网络环境下进行交易可能会被黑客截获重要信息,因此尽量在安全的网络环境中使用钱包。

了解钓鱼攻击:用户需清楚钓鱼网站的特征并提高警惕,避免点击可疑链接或输入账户信息。

比特币钱包的未来趋势是什么?

随着比特币及其他数字货币的普及,比特币钱包的未来趋势将呈现几个方向:

便捷性:未来的钱包将更加专注于用户体验,使得交易更加简便,甚至可能通过生物识别等新技术进行身份验证。

多功能性:集合更多的金融服务,例如借贷、交易和资产管理,让钱包不仅仅是存储工具,而是一个综合的金融平台。

安全技术的提高:随着技术的不断进步,钱包的安全性将得到进一步提高。如量子耐受性加密技术等新兴技术的应用将使得钱包更加安全。

总之,比特币钱包是数字货币生态系统中不可或缺的一部分。了解其创建背景、类型以及安全性是每一个投资者必须掌握的基础知识,未来,钱包的功能和安全性也将随着技术的发展不断进化,为用户提供更好的服务。